Hold onto your sunhats, eco-warriors! The largest solar project in Southeast Asia just flipped the 'on' switch this Tuesday in Laos 🇱🇦. Developed by China's energy heavyweight CGN, this 1-gigawatt powerhouse is lighting up regional climate goals like a TikTok trend 🔥.

Mountains & Megawatts 🏔️

This isn't your average solar farm – it's Laos' first large-scale photovoltaic project built on rugged mountain terrain. Talk about leveling up the literal high ground of renewable energy! 🌄

Cross-Border Energy Handshake 🤝

Part of northern Laos' clean energy base, this project supercharges China's Belt and Road green initiatives. One CGN rep told CMG: 'We're not just sharing power – we're sparking sustainable growth across borders.' 💡
